titleOfInvention Connector and semiconductor inspection method and device using the same
abstract (57) [Abstract] [PROBLEMS] To provide a connector that improves economy and connection reliability in the inspection of electronic components such as a semiconductor integrated circuit device, and a semiconductor inspection method and device using the connector. [Structure] A plate-shaped insulating elastic member 1 having a plurality of conductive thin wires 2 having connection ends on the front and back surfaces, and an exposed surface 3 on which a semiconductor integrated circuit device or a test substrate is arranged. An insulating thin film member 3 in which an electrode 6 is provided on a and a thin film conductive layer 3c electrically connected to the electrode 6 via a wiring 7 is provided on a bonding surface 3b for bonding to the front surface or the back surface of the insulating elastic member 1. The insulating elastic member 1 is sandwiched and joined between the two insulating thin film members 3 so that each thin film conductive layer 3c is electrically connected to the connecting end of the conductive thin wire 2. .
